Output 17580701afbca26ecc4c81e52ff481d3761c58175c92e9ac275dbca080aa8f22:1
- value
- 9411691
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 035937c486b51a35cac5a004760389106afda5b3 OP_EQUAL
- address
- M8Cs8yDWLPzQq5UyMy6dZyQwQYLy6RXB8Y
- transaction
- 17580701afbca26ecc4c81e52ff481d3761c58175c92e9ac275dbca080aa8f22
- spent
- true